Mobile “Happy tears, it’s all happy tears” Oct’19, Day 5 - Animal Kingdom Live

Hi everyone,

We woke up at 7.30 today and got ready and hit the bus stop at 8.30 and there was a bus waiting for us! We were really excited for Animal Kingdom as we had a fastpass for FOP for the first time.




We arrived in the park at 8.50 and Safari already had a wait of over 90 minutes so we went to Everest as this was showing 15 minutes, it was pretty accurate so we were off within 25 minutes. I got Sam back for bunny earring Charlie and I earlier in the holiday



We decided to go straight to our FP for FOP. Wow. We loved it and I notoriously hate simulator rides! Amazing and we are so happy we have another FP for Thursday.

After this we got our favourite 2 x pongo lumpia’s and a night blossom, I used 1 x QS credit to pay for the 3 snacks. I forgot to picture the night blossom so this is from google and is missing our glowing lotus flower



Charlie didn’t like the pongo lumpia so we got him a lion paw cookie which was really nice - I helpfully tried it for research purposes.


We then did our 2nd FP for Everest, Sam pulled a cool pose!


And we headed off to catch the train to Radikis planet watch for our 3rd fastpass. Animation experience.


First they showed us the breed of parrots responsible for inspiring Iago from Aladdin.


Then we were up to draw tick tock from Peter Pan in honour of national reptile day. We enjoyed this. None of us are natural artists at all and we were pleased with what we made. Top left our animator instructors, top right Sams, bottom left Charlie’s and bottom right mine:


We then got the train back and mobile ordered at Harambe for a chicken bowl and roasted vegetable bowl. We got a bud light with sangria and used a snack credit for a frozen passion fruit drink for Charlie.

We really enjoyed this as it felt like proper food. Whilst we were eating I booked a fastpass for Dinosaur for an hours time and after lunch we queued for Safari as it showed a 45 minute wait. This was more like 25 minutes and I was convinced we wouldn’t see anything as it was so hot at the middle of the day but I was wrong...

Safari done we headed over to Dinosaur and rode this. I love this ride. I think it’s great fun - my pic says different mind you!


I booked us another fast pass for Kali River rapids then as Sam really wanted to do it. We all got soaked which was welcomed as it was so humid and hot!

We then went over to it’s tough to be a bug which we all loved before heading over to our 5pm reservation for Restaurantosaurus burgers and sundaes at 5pm. Halfway there this happened..

We sheltered under a shopping station for 20 minutes and with no sign of it easing up we had to make a run for it for our reservation, I was in big trouble for saying “leave the ponchos it won’t rain today” this morning 😬😬

We were drenched but we got in and ordered our burgers, you sit in a roped off area and they bring the food, we went for 2 x American burgers, 1 x mushroom, Gouda and onion jam veggie burger and for our sides 2x fries and 1x onion rings. Sam and I had bud light and a margarita

We enjoyed this a lot. You get dinosaur stencils to draw on your paper tablecloths


And also a token for the sundae bar where you get 2 x scoops ice cream and then head to the toppings bar to create your own. There’s great toppings like cookies, brownies, Oreo, sprinkles, whipped cream and cherries


This was a great experience and a great use of 3 x QS credits, the food was great. A million times better than ABC the night before. I’d definitely recommend this one.

3 x very happy campers we headed back to the hotel and as the sun was back out we decided to head to the pool. Charlie loved hanging out in the dark at the dig site and I liked the hot tub very much indeed! We also played some table tennis before getting showered at 8 and going for a drink at the dahlia lounge intending to watch the fireworks, except the balcony was shut due to high winds damaging the lighting earlier so we couldn’t see anything. The lounge is stunning and we enjoyed our drinks, a glass of wine and a beer was $26.
